Ilorin South Chalet inferno: Commissioner Commiserates with Council

Date: 2020-09-24

The Kwara State Government has commiserated with Ilorin South Local Government Council over the fire incident that gutted the official Chalet of the Council situated along Fate Road in Ilorin.

The Commissioner for Local Government, Chieftaincy Affairs and Community Development, Arc. Aliyu Muhammad Saifuddeen made the commiseration when he visited the scene of the fire incident to asses the extent of the damage.

The Commissioner, who was accompanied on the visit by the Chairman, Kwara State Local Government Service Commission, Alhaji Umar Danladi Shero and other top government officials, described the inferno as rather unfortunate. According to him, the ugly fire incident was at a time when the recent rainstorm in Ilorin had destroyed properties worth millions of naira and render many people homeless.

Arc. Saifuddeen directed the Council to avail his office with a comprehensive report on the cause of the inferno in order to ascertain the level of damage and prevent future occurrence.

In his remarks, the Chairman of the State Local Government Service Commission, Alhaji Umar Danladi Shero commended the Commissioner for his timely visit despite his busy schedule.

Shero assured that necessary measures would be put in place to forestall future occurrence.

The Director, Personnel Management of Ilorin South Local Government, Hajia Balkis Bello had earlier briefed the Commissioner of how she received a distress call at about 7:30 pm on Sunday that the Council's Chalet was on fire.

She explained that she immediately swung into action by informing the State Fire Service for its intervention, pointing out that before the arrival of the fire fighters at the scene of the incident, the entire building had been razed down. Oba Azeez,
